Data Analysis of Jersey Numbers
- Data: 78, 81, 54, 2, 26, 13, 66, 23, 77, 15, 3
- Mean: (Sum of values) / (Number of values) = 44.36, approximate
- Median: Middle value in ascending order = 26
- Mode: Most frequent value = There is no mode. No value appears more than once.
- Midrange: (Highest value + Lowest value) / 2 = (81 + 2)/2 = 41.5
Interpretation of Results
- Mean and Median: These give different estimations of the average jersey number.
- Midrange: This measure shows the range of the data.
- Mode: In this data set, it is not useful as there is no repeated value.
- Nominal Data: Jersey numbers are categories and thus the statistical measure is not meaningful in a typical sense. The numbers just assigned to represent categories.
